Deciphering RTP: The Cornerstone of Transparent Gaming
RTP is expressed as a percentage indicating the theoretical return a player can expect over the long term. For instance, a slot with an RTP of 96% suggests that, on average, players will receive €96 back for every €100 wagered, over an extended period. While individual sessions may deviate significantly, the RTP serves as a reliable indicator of a game’s inherent payout potential.
Industry leaders emphasize that a game’s RTP is instrumental in maintaining player trust, especially in a market saturated with games boasting various features and themes. Transparency in RTP figures is increasingly regarded as a hallmark of reputable operators and game developers.

Implications of RTP Variations: The Fine Line Between Fairness and Profitability
It is important to recognise that RTPs are not static; they can vary based on regional regulations, game versions, and casino policies. For example, some jurisdictions mandate minimum RTP thresholds to protect consumers, while operators might tweak game settings to optimise revenue streams.
In the context of Eye of Horus, variations in RTP figures—often a minor percentage—can influence player perception. A higher RTP can be a persuasive selling point, boosting confidence in the game’s fairness. Conversely, lower RTPs might be perceived as less player-friendly, potentially impacting the game’s popularity.
